Transaction 93567b5bc63974021278e6858f2d7905ab4fed96fb249cdad25e6e5b51e90136
1 Input
1 Output
-
93567b5bc63974021278e6858f2d7905ab4fed96fb249cdad25e6e5b51e90136:0
- value
- 716353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e61f7eb15d5ae5eb66d487cff008fc01a7ee065 OP_EQUAL
- address
- 34TfZGJHqSYRxG3CUBBHcNci247m3qpV2g